Physical SafetyPlay
Use 'watch out for' when warning others about immediate physical dangers or hazards. SlideWatch out for the wet floor; it's slippery.

Figurative SensePlay
Sometimes 'watch out for' can indicate being cautious about non-physical threats, like scams. SlideWatch out for online scams when shopping.

Sudden OccurrencesPlay
It can be used when something happens suddenly and requires immediate attention or action. SlideWatch out for sudden changes in the weather.
